Abstract

Homozygous and compound heterozygous pathogenic variants in GNB5 have been recently associated with a spectrum of clinical presentations varying from a severe multisystem form of the disorder including intellectual disability, early infantile developmental and epileptic encephalopathy, retinal abnormalities and cardiac arrhythmias (IDDCA) to a milder form with language delay, attention-deficit/hyperactivity disorder, cognitive impairment, with or without cardiac arrhythmia (LADCI). Approximately twenty patients have been described so far; here we report a novel case of a 2.5-year-old female who is a compound heterozygote for a frameshift and a missense variant in the GNB5 gene. Her clinical presentation is consistent with a moderate phenotype, corroborating the direct correlation between the type and pathogenic mechanism of the GNB5 genetic variant and the severity of related phenotype.

(A) Family pedigree investigated in this study. Filled symbols represent: hypotonia (bottom left quarter), severe sick sinus syndrome (SSS; top left quarter), seizure (bottom right quarter), and intellectual disability (ID; top right quarter). (B) Distribution of the GNB5 variants (NM_006578) across the gene with exons indicated by gray boxes. The frameshift variants are designated in bold, missense variants are in gray, and nonsense variants are in black. The number of patients with each variant is indicated in parentheses. (C) Schematic representation of the GNB5 protein with Coiled coil and WD-40 repeats domains.
